The market town of Pocklington nestles at the foot of the Yorkshire Wolds in the Vale of York. Renowned for Burnby Hall Gardens - 8 acres of gardens with two large lakes which are home to the National Collection of water lilies. There are several world famous attractions nearby - majestic Castle Howard, beautiful Sledmere House, and of course the historic city of York. Pocklington is also home to Madhyamaka Kadampa Meditation Centre, known worldwide for its meditation courses and retreats, plus the KP Golf Club is situated approx. 1 mile away and offers a championshiop 18-hole course. Just a few miles away is the village of Warter, which is where David Hockney produced his 'Bigger Trees Near Warter' painting. Nearby are various cycle ways including the North Sea Cycle Route and walkers will love either the long distance walks along the Wolds Way or one of the many more circular walks in the area for all abilities.

    If your group/party is large, this property has plenty of space. Infact in some rooms the furniture looks small and out of place. The beds are okay, quality bedding and linen. There is plenty of crockery and cutlery. Some of the glassware had to be washed before use! For a large group, the saucepans etc was not adequate. The cooking utensils and knives have seen better days - a wobbly knife blade is dangerous. A range would be better for a large party rather than a four ring hob and separate oven. Living room furniture was okay but lacked back support. No bins in livingrooms or bedrooms! Each room needs a bin. Also chairs in bedrooms - sparcely furnished so lacked comfort. Bathroom facilities/showers need grab rails - chose a single storey property especially for older person who's a bit wobbly! The instructions for heating, water heating and refuse collection could be improved. More generous black bin bags - one is not practicable for a group of this size, and some laundry detergent. Plenty of parking, public footpaths to follow. Lovely views across fields and big skies. Okay overall but needs improvements.
